Problem
Existing information processing technologies fail to explicitly indicate particular information to recipients when displaying operation target data with animation features, leading to unclear understanding and unnecessary printed sheets.
Innovation Solution
An information processing apparatus that includes an interpreter module to acquire and generate electronic data from an electronic document, using selection information to prioritize display data over secondary data, reducing the easy-read performance of secondary data to ensure specific information is not immediately apparent, thereby enhancing the presentation's clarity and reducing printed output.

An information processing apparatus processes an electronic document including operation target data items. The electronic document is controlled by a processor performing an interpreter module which includes a first acquisition instruction for acquiring edit information, a second acquisition instruction for acquiring relevance information, and a generation instruction for generating electronic data from the electronic document based on the edit information and the relevance information. The relevance information includes first selection information for selecting some operation target data item, and second selection information for selecting another operation target data item. The electronic data includes first display data which is displayed based on the some operation target data item, and second display data which is displayed based on the another operation target data item in order that easy-to-read performance of the second display data is decreased to be lower than the first display data.
